The All Sagalee Students Union (ASSU) has submitted a complaint with Sagalee Police Station to take necessary action against three women teachers of the Kasturba Gandhi Balika Vidyalaya, Tani Happa (New Sagalee) for allegedly forcing 88 school children to undress in front of other students. The three teachers Thinley Wangmu Thongdok, Sangeeta Khalkho and Nabam Janu allegedly ordered 88 students of sixth and seventh standards to undress before other students on 23rd November as punishment after some students wrote some inappropriate writings in a small piece of paper. According to the information provided by the students, out of the 88 students, 14 were forced to get naked, while the rest were partly unclothed, with warnings not to disclose the matter to anyone. Apart from AASU, the All Papum Pare District Students' Union (APPDSU) also demanded for immediate termination of service of Thondok, Khalkho and Nabam for the crime. But, when students submit their complaints in the complain box addressed to the chairman of the school, the teachers allegedly check the letters beforehand and the issues go unnoticed, said the students.
